MySQL修改字段性别男或女, 默认男实现流程
为了实现“mysql修改字段性别男或女,默认男”,我们需要按照以下步骤进行操作。
步骤一:创建数据表
首先,我们需要创建一个数据表来存储相关数据。在这个案例中,我们可以创建一个名为users
的数据表,其中包含以下字段:
字段名 | 类型 | 说明 |
---|---|---|
id | int | 用户ID |
name | varchar | 用户名 |
gender | varchar | 用户性别 |
你可以使用以下SQL语句来创建users
表:
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
name VARCHAR(255),
gender VARCHAR(255)
)
步骤二:插入初始数据
接下来,我们需要插入一些初始数据到users
表中。这样我们才能进行修改字段的操作。你可以使用以下SQL语句插入一条初始数据:
INSERT INTO users (name, gender) VALUES ('小明', '男')
步骤三:修改字段
现在我们可以开始修改字段了。我们可以使用ALTER TABLE
语句来修改gender
字段的默认值为男
。你可以使用以下SQL语句来执行修改操作:
ALTER TABLE users
MODIFY COLUMN gender VARCHAR(255) DEFAULT '男'
在这个语句中,我们使用ALTER TABLE
关键字来修改表结构,MODIFY COLUMN
关键字用于修改字段,DEFAULT '男'
表示将gender
字段的默认值设置为男
。
步骤四:验证修改结果
最后,我们需要验证修改结果是否正确。你可以使用以下SQL语句来查询users
表的所有数据:
SELECT * FROM users
如果修改成功,你应该能够看到gender
字段的默认值为男
。
总结
在本文中,我们学习了如何通过MySQL来修改字段性别男或女,默认男。我们按照步骤创建了数据表,插入了初始数据,修改了字段的默认值,并验证了修改结果。希望这篇文章能帮助到你入门MySQL的相关操作。
以下是本文中使用到的代码和关系图:
### 创建数据表
```sql
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
name VARCHAR(255),
gender VARCHAR(255)
)
插入初始数据
INSERT INTO users (name, gender) VALUES ('小明', '男')
修改字段
ALTER TABLE users
MODIFY COLUMN gender VARCHAR(255) DEFAULT '男'
验证修改结果
SELECT * FROM users
erDiagram
users ||--o{ id : int
users ||--o{ name : varchar
users ||--o{ gender : varchar